Description
The WATKINS 32 is a mid-sized cruiser designed by William H. Tripp Jr.. Built for serious cruising, she offers reassuring stability in all conditions, Her generous sail plan delivers excellent light-air performance. A capable coastal cruiser with the ability to handle longer passages comfortably.
